अर्जुनदुःखहेतुप्रश्नः — Inquiry into the cause of Arjuna’s recurring hardship

Book 14, Chapter 89

निष्क्रयो दीयतां महां ब्राह्मणा हि धनार्थिन: । “नृपश्रेष्ठ! तुम्हारी दी हुई इस पृथ्वीको मैं पुनः तुम्हारे ही अधिकारमें छोड़ता हूँ। तुम मुझे इसका मूल्य दे दो; क्योंकि ब्राह्मण धनके ही इच्छुक होते हैं (राज्यके नहीं)”

niṣkrayo dīyatāṃ mahān brāhmaṇā hi dhanārthinaḥ |

Vaiśampāyana said: “Let a great ransom (price) be paid, for brāhmaṇas seek wealth. O best of kings, I return this earth that you have given and place it again under your authority. Give me its value, because brāhmaṇas desire wealth—not dominion.”
